IIRC Recaro seats were only fitted to the D2's which had sport suspension, so the S8 and Quattro Sport. The standard Quattro and 2.8 FWD both had armchair style front seats with vertical leather padding.

The is one blank button on the dash but looking at the manual it shows an ASR button to be there for the FWD models? Bugs me i have a blank
ASR is anti slip regulation for the 2wd 2.8 and 3.7. ESP was for quattros but not available until 1997.....
